With significant expertise in environmental law and energy projects, Abreu Advogados is skilled at assisting with public contracting, tenders, administrative concessions and PPPs. The practice is led by Manuel de Andrade Neves, recognised for his considerable expertise in conventional and renewable energy projects in Portugal and abroad. José Eduardo Martins is proficient in licensing, public procurement and litigation in the waste management, water and energy sectors, advising both companies and public entities in Portugal and Lusophone Africa. Mafalda Teixeira de Abreu is another name to note for public procurement procedures.

Work highlights

  • Assisted Iberdrola Generación with all its major projects in Portugal over the last 18 years.
  • Assisted Copenhagen Offshore Partners with its Offshore Wind-farm project (6 GW) which is to be implemented in Portugal.
  • Assisted Alsa/Nexcontinental with two public tenders launched by the AREA METROPOLITANA DE LISBOA (AML) and the AREA METROPOLITANA DO PORTO (AMP) for the region of Lisbon (15 municipalities) and Oporto (17 municipalities).
